What part of the Civil Rights Act of 1964 prohibits employment disc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ex or national origin and applies to private employers, labor unions, and employment agencies. The Act prohibits discrimination in recruitment, hiring, wages, assignment, promotions, benefits, discipline, discharge, layoffs, and almost every aspect of employment.
